General Information: Note: Note: Towing

Avoid towing vehicles except when the vehicle cannot be driven. For models with AWD, CVT, AT or VTD, use a loader instead of towing. When towing other vehicles, pay attention to the following to prevent hook or vehicle damage resulting from excessive weight.

CAUTION:
  • Place the shift lever in "N" position during towing.
  • Do not lift up the rear wheels to avoid unsteady rotation.
  • Turn the ignition key to "ACC", then check the steering wheel moves freely. (Models without the keyless access with push button start system)
  • Release the parking brake to avoid tire dragging.
  • Since the power steering does not work, be careful for the heavy steering effort. (When engine is stopped)
  • Since the servo brake does not work, be careful that the brake is not applied effectively. (When engine is stopped)
  • In case of the malfunction of internal transmission or drive system, lift up four wheels (on a trailer) for towing.
  • Do not use towing hook (eye bolt) except when towing.
  • Make sure to detach the towing hook (eye bolt) after towing. If it remains attached, airbag may not operate properly when receiving a shock. And it may also affect the crash performance of the vehicle.
